A Historic Gem in Midtown Detroit

Opened in 1915 and designed by renowned architect C. Howard Crane, the Majestic Theatre is one of Detroit’s most iconic entertainment venues. Originally one of the world’s largest movie theaters, it has since evolved into a vibrant hub for live music, cultural events, and private functions

What to Expect at the Majestic

Majestic Theatre

The Majestic Theatre hosts a wide variety of performances—from indie rock and hip-hop to jazz, electronic, and world music. Past performers include:

  • Post Malone
  • The Black Keys
  • Patti Smith
  • Drake
  • St. Vincent
  • Leon Bridges

With a 1,100-person capacity, two full-service bars, and a newly renovated lobby, the venue offers an intimate yet electric concert experience

More Than Just Music

The Majestic complex includes:

  • The Garden Bowl – America’s oldest active bowling alley
  • Sgt. Pepperoni’s – A retro-style pizza joint
  • The Alley Deck – A rooftop bar with skyline views
  • The Magic Stick – A second music venue for more intimate shows
